Title: Ralph Palmer Merritt papers
Creator:
Merritt, Ralph Palmer
Identifier/Call Number: LSC.0807
Physical Description:
0.5 Linear Feet
(1 box)
Date (inclusive): circa 1940-1950
Abstract: Merritt was born on February 26, 1883 in Rio Vista, California. He received his BS, University of California, Berkeley, 1907.
He was the president and managing director of Sun Maid Raisin Growers from 1923-28 and later became the project director for
United States War Relocation Authority (WRA) at Manzanar War Relocation Center, California, from November 1942-March 1946.
He served as UC Regent from 1923-30. The collection consists of correspondence, clippings, pictures, printed materials, and
books related to Camp Hahn and the Death Valley All Souls Memorial Association. Includes materials related to the Manzanar
War Relocation Center and Camp Hahn, California.

Biography
Merritt was born on February 26, 1883 in Rio Vista, California; BS, University of California at Berkeley, 1907; president
and managing director, Sun Maid Raisin Growers, 1923-28; project director for US War Relocation Authority (WRA) at Manzanar
War Relocation Center, California, November 1942-March 1946; UC Regent, 1923-30; died on April 3, 1963 in Los Angeles, California.
Scope and Content
Collection consists of correspondence, clippings, pictures, printed materials, and books related to Camp Hahn and the Death
Valley All Souls Memorial Association. Includes materials related to the Manzanar War Relocation Center and Camp Hahn, California.
